Lipid abnormalities in uraemic patients on chronic haemodialysis

Abstract:
Patients kept on haemodialysis because of chronic renal insufficiency were investigated for lipid profiles. The cholesterol level did not differ as compared to the age-matched control, while the triglyceride level was elevated. The correlation was found between the lipid parameters, period spent in dialysis programme and level of serum creatinine and urea. In renal failures of different origin the lipid levels are in relationship with the underlying disorders.
